Provisioning Ubuntu Autoinstall
Foreman supports provisioning hosts running Debian and Ubuntu on VMware, Proxmox, cloud providers such as Microsoft Azure, and bare metal hosts. With the Katello plug-in, provisioned and registered hosts receive versioned DEB content based on their lifecycle. This blog article is a short summary of what happened behind the scenes to provisioning hosts running Ubuntu 20.04.3+, why you need new templates, and how to use the new deployment mechanism.

Integrating Foreman with Event-Driven Ansible
Event-Driven Ansible is a new way of automation where your automation can dynamically react to events that happen in your environment. Today, we want to show you how you can integrate that with Foreman using the Foreman Webhooks plugin.
